Estrella Morente, a leading light in flamenco music today, will be performing at the Capitol Gran Vía on 12 November, singing the greatest hits of her career.
Estrella Morente, the daughter of Enrique Morente and flamenco dancer Aurora Carbonell, already has an extensive career to her name and is one of the most important young flamenco singers on the scene today. With a crystal-clear voice, she moves with ease between suggestive warm tones and emotional phrasing.
She made her début in 2001 with the album Mi cante y un poema, produced by her father. Since then, she has released a further eight albums including one most recently in 2021, entitled Leo. She has also featured on the soundtracks of the films Sobreviviré by Alfonso Albacete and David Menkes, Volver by Pedro Almodóvar and Chico y Rita by Fernando Trueba. Her career has been paved with success and awards, receiving the Ondas Award for Best Flamenco Creation, and the Music Award for Best Flamenco Album.
She has also received two Amigo Awards and was nominated for the Latin Grammy in 2006. Her albums include Mi cante y un poema (2001), Mujeres (2006), Autorretrato (2012) and Amar en paz (2014).
She has everything it takes to be one of the truly great artists of flamenco and Spanish song: an exceptional voice, sense of rhythm, passion and curiosity to explore and incorporate new light and shade into her style.
